Understanding the Basics of Real Estate Investing

Understanding the Basics of Real Estate Investing is a crucial first step for any beginner looking to enter this lucrative market. One often overlooked yet highly profitable segment in real estate investing is investment property house clearance. This strategy involves purchasing and renovating distressed properties, then selling them at a higher value, or renting them out for consistent income streams. For instance, according to recent industry reports, the UK's house clearance sector has seen an average annual growth rate of 10% over the past decade, underscoring its potential as a lucrative investment opportunity.
Maximizing investment returns requires a keen understanding of legal risks and rewards inherent in real estate deals. Property owners face various challenges, such as unforeseen repairs, regulatory compliance issues, and market fluctuations. However, these risks can be mitigated with thorough due diligence, expert advice, and proper planning. For example, a prudent investor might engage professional services for house clearance, ensuring they stay within legal boundaries and maximize profits by avoiding costly mistakes.
Profit margins in house clearance can be substantial when executed well. A strategic approach involves identifying undervalued properties, assessing their renovation potential, and factoring in market trends for optimal sales or rental returns. Consider a case where an investor purchases a distressed property in a revitalizing neighborhood, clears it, and renovates it to modern standards. Post-renovation, the property's value might increase by 30-50%, leading to significant capital gains.

Securing Financing: Loans and Financing Options Explained

Securing Financing for Your Investment Property House Clearance is a crucial step in your journey as a beginner real estate investor. Understanding various loan options and financing strategies can make all the difference between a successful venture and a financial burden. When diving into this process, beginners should familiarize themselves with the market's dynamics to make informed decisions. One of the primary considerations is determining the budget for each investment, which directly impacts the scope of your property house clearance activities.
Loans play a pivotal role in funding your real estate endeavors, especially when acquiring an investment property that requires significant renovations or clearance. Traditional mortgage loans from banks are readily available and offer fixed-rate options, providing stability and predictability. Alternatively, hard money loans, often facilitated by private lenders, cater to quick approvals and flexible terms, making them appealing for urgent investments. As a beginner, comparing interest rates, loan terms, and requirements across different financial institutions is essential.
